Help us change the face of creative leadership

AnalogFolk is proud to announce the launch of an exciting and ambitious campaign to address the critical issue of declining diversity and inclusion and lack of visibility of female creative leadership in the industry. 

It simply asks the question - if the advertising legends we know today were women, would they have reached the same heights? 

Despite women comprising 54.7% of the creative industry, the pool of diverse and female creative talent remains strikingly small. This scarcity is further exacerbated by the fact that many talented leaders are not always the most visible. As AnalogFolk embarked on its search for a Head of Creative, it became clear that the current talent pool is neither diverse nor balanced. 

That’s why, for our Head of Creative role, we are calling on the industry to participate in recommending outstanding diverse and female creative talent to create an Open Source pool of talent that all agencies can share and utilise to help meet their DEI targets and drive the industry forward.
